On June 19, Gong Yoo posted several casual snapshots with the Tottenham Hotspur captain, donning Son Heung-min‘s first-ever UEFA Europa League championship medal with a proud grin. The caption simply read: “Respect!!” but the images spoke volumes.
Dressed down in t-shirts, jeans, and caps, the duo looked relaxed yet charismatic. Gong Yoo’s model-like poise contrasted endearingly with Son’s cheerful, younger-brother energy.
In one standout photo, Son Heung-min leans affectionately on Gong Yoo’s shoulder. Another image showed Gong Yoo holding a signed jersey from Son that included a heartfelt note, “Hyungnim. Even though you couldn’t be at the match, your support helped me achieve this incredible victory. I’m truly grateful. I’ll never forget your sincere advice and support by my side. I’ll always have your back, no matter what happens. Love you! – Ggomm.”


Son also shared the same photos on his account, captioned “Ggomm Respect♥,” referencing Gong Yoo’s nickname.
The actor-athlete bromance is well-documented. Gong Yoo previously shared photos with Son’s Golden Boot award, and the two have reportedly celebrated birthdays together. Son even affectionately mentioned Gong Yoo during a guest appearance on Salon Drip 2, calling him “Ggomm.”

Gong Yoo is currently filming Show Business alongside Song Hye-kyo, written by acclaimed screenwriter Noh Hee-kyung. Meanwhile, Son Heung-min is enjoying a brief break after completing Korea’s third-round qualifiers for the 2026 FIFA World Cup.
